#include <stdio.h>
#include <stdlib.h>
int * arrayMax(int * array, int n) {
if (n == 0){
return NULL;
}
int maxInt = array[0];
int * answer = array;
for (int i = 1; i < n; i++) {
if (array[i] > maxInt) {
maxInt = array[i];
answer = &array[i];
}
}
return answer;
}
void doTest(int * array, int n) {
printf("arrayMax(");
if (array == NULL) {
printf("NULL");
}
else {
printf("{");
for (int i =0; i < n; i++) {
printf("%d", array[i]);
if (i < n -1) {
printf(", ");
}
}
printf("}");
}
printf(", %d) is \n", n);
int * p = arrayMax (array, n);
if (p == NULL) {
printf("NULL\n");
}
else {
printf("%d\n", *p);
}
}
int main(void) {
int array1[] = { 77, 33, 19, 99, 42, 6, 27, 4};
int array2[] = { -3, -42, -99, -1000, -999, -88, -77};
int array3[] = { 425, 59, -3, 77, 0, 36};
doTest (array1, 8);
doTest (array2, 7);
doTest (array3, 6);
doTest (NULL, 0);
doTest (array1, 0);
return EXIT_SUCCESS;
}
